What are the Initial Steps and Key Considerations in Amusement Park Design?

The journey to building an amusement park begins long before the first ride is installed. Initial steps involve comprehensive market research to identify target demographics, assess local competition, and pinpoint unique selling propositions. This feeds into the conceptualization phase, where a compelling theme and vision for the park are developed. A detailed master plan then outlines the park's layout, zoning, infrastructure (utilities, roadways, parking), and projected visitor flow. Crucially, a robust feasibility study assesses financial viability, potential return on investment (ROI), and identifies potential risks. Engaging experienced consultants, architects, and ride manufacturers early in this phase ensures that design decisions are grounded in practical reality, regulatory compliance, and a clear understanding of future operational costs.

How Do Safety Standards and Regulations Impact Ride Selection and Park Layout?

Safety is the cornerstone of the amusement park industry, and rigorous standards and regulations dictate every aspect of ride design, manufacturing, installation, and operation. Key international standards include ASTM F24 (Standard Practice for Design and Manufacture of Amusement Rides and Devices) in the United States and EN 13814 (Safety of Fairs and Amusement Parks Machinery and Structures) in Europe. Adherence to these standards is not merely a legal requirement but a fundamental aspect of risk mitigation. They influence everything from material specifications and structural integrity to restraint systems, emergency stop procedures, and operational protocols. For park layout, safety considerations include adequate space for queue lines, clear emergency egress routes, sufficient maintenance access, and effective crowd management strategies. Non-compliance can lead to severe penalties, operational shutdowns, catastrophic accidents, and significant liability claims. The industry's commitment to safety is reflected in statistics; for instance, fixed-site amusement rides in the U.S. have a remarkably low serious injury rate, estimated at 1.5 injuries per million visitors in 2021, underscoring the effectiveness of stringent safety protocols when properly implemented.

What Specific Insurance Types are Crucial for Amusement Parks, and How Do They Relate to Design?

An amusement park's design choices have a direct and substantial impact on its insurance profile and overall liability. Several types of insurance are essential:

  • General Liability Insurance: This covers third-party bodily injury or property damage that occurs on park premises. Design flaws, inadequate signage, or insufficient safety features directly increase exposure to general liability claims.
  • Property Insurance: Protects park assets like rides, buildings, and infrastructure from damage due to perils like fire, storms, or vandalism. High-quality, durable design materials can reduce property damage risks.
  • Workers' Compensation: Covers employee injuries sustained on the job. Safe ride design and accessible maintenance areas contribute to a safer work environment, potentially reducing claims.
  • Business Interruption Insurance: Provides coverage for lost income and operating expenses if the park is forced to close due to a covered peril. Well-designed, reliable rides with robust maintenance plans can minimize unexpected downtime.
  • Excess/Umbrella Liability: Provides additional coverage beyond the limits of primary liability policies, crucial given the potential for high-value claims in the amusement industry.
  • Professional Liability (Errors & Omissions) Insurance: Important for designers, engineers, and consultants, covering claims arising from errors or omissions in their professional services, directly linking back to design quality.

Insurers meticulously assess park design, ride specifications, maintenance schedules, and safety records when determining High Qualitys. Designs that incorporate redundant safety systems, use certified high-quality materials, and prioritize ease of inspection and maintenance are viewed more favorably, potentially leading to lower High Qualitys and better coverage terms.

How Does Amusement Ride Design Directly Affect Insurance High Qualitys and Overall Liability?

The choice and design of amusement rides are perhaps the most significant factors influencing insurance High Qualitys and liability. Insurers evaluate risk based on several design-related aspects:

  • Complexity & Novelty: Highly complex or entirely novel ride designs often come with higher High Qualitys due to less historical data on performance and potential unforeseen risks. Proven designs adhering to established standards are generally less risky.
  • Safety Features: The integration of multiple, redundant safety systems (e.g., dual braking systems, independent restraint checks, emergency stop protocols) demonstrates a proactive approach to risk management, which can positively impact insurance assessments.
  • Material Quality & Durability: Rides constructed from certified, high-quality, corrosion-resistant materials are perceived as more reliable and less prone to mechanical failure, reducing the likelihood of incidents and thus liability.
  • Maintenance Accessibility & Requirements: Designs that allow for easy, thorough, and safe inspection and maintenance reduce the risk of mechanical failures stemming from neglected upkeep. Manufacturers providing clear maintenance manuals and training are preferred.
  • Operational Protocols: Ride design must inherently support clear, unambiguous operational procedures. Poorly designed rides that are difficult to operate safely increase the risk of human error and subsequent liability.

What Role Does Innovative Technology Play in Modern Amusement Park Design, Operations, and Risk Mitigation?

Technological advancements are revolutionizing amusement park design, operations, and, critically, risk mitigation.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R) are being integrated into attractions to create immersive, novel experiences, often with fewer physical risks than traditional rides. Beyond guest experience, technology plays a vital safety role:

  • Advanced Simulation Software: Engineers use sophisticated simulation tools to test ride dynamics, stress points, and safety parameters digitally before physical construction, identifying potential design flaws early.
  • AI-Powered Predictive Maintenance: Sensors embedded in rides collect real-time data on component wear, temperature, and performance. AI algorithms analyze this data to predict potential failures, allowing for proactive maintenance before an issue escalates into a breakdown or safety hazard.
  • Smart Monitoring Systems: Centralized control systems with smart sensors provide real-time oversight of ride operations, passenger restraints, and environmental conditions, flagging anomalies instantly.
  • Crowd Management & Security: AI-driven analytics can monitor crowd flow, identify bottlenecks, and detect unusual behavior, enhancing security and preventing potential incidents.

These technologies contribute not only to a superior guest experience but also significantly enhance operational safety, reduce downtime, and provide data-driven insights that can be invaluable in demonstrating a proactive risk management strategy to insurers.

Ensuring Accessibility and Inclusivity: ADA Compliance in Park Design

The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) in the U.S. (and similar accessibility laws globally) mandates that public accommodations, including amusement parks, must be accessible to individuals with disabilities. This is a critical design and liability factor. Compliance affects:

  • Pathways and Ramps: Ensuring all guest paths, including queue lines, meet width, slope, and surface requirements.
  • Restrooms and Facilities: Providing accessible restrooms, changing stations, and service counters.
  • Ride Accessibility: This is a complex area. While not every ride must be accessible, parks must provide a reasonable number of accessible rides and offer clear information on accessibility features. This can involve transfer devices, accessible loading platforms, and specific design considerations for guests with mobility impairments, visual impairments, or other disabilities.
  • Communication: Clear signage, accessible maps, and staff training on assisting guests with disabilities are also vital components.

Failure to comply with ADA standards can lead to significant lawsuits, hefty fines, and severe reputational damage. Proactive design that integrates accessibility from the outset is far more cost-effective and creates a more inclusive environment for all guests, broadening the park's appeal.

How Can Strategic Ride Procurement and Design Enhance Long-Term Park Profitability?

Profitability in amusement park operations is not just about ticket sales; it's deeply intertwined with design and procurement decisions. Strategic choices can significantly enhance long-term profitability:

  • Quality and Durability: Investing in high-quality, durable rides from reputable manufacturers like SUNHONG reduces maintenance costs, minimizes downtime, and extends the operational lifespan of attractions. This lowers total cost of ownership (TCO) and ensures consistent guest satisfaction.
  • Innovation and Uniqueness: Offering unique, innovative, and highly-themed rides can differentiate a park, attract more visitors, and justify higher ticket prices.
  • Operational Efficiency: Efficient park layout, optimized ride capacities, and designs that streamline guest flow and minimize staffing requirements contribute to lower operational costs.
  • Energy Efficiency & Sustainability: Designs incorporating energy-efficient systems (e.g., LED lighting, high-efficiency motors, water recycling) reduce utility bills, aligning with modern sustainability goals and enhancing brand image.
  • Future Expansion Planning: A master plan that considers future growth and infrastructure expansion from the outset avoids costly retrofits down the line.

By making informed procurement decisions and prioritizing design excellence that balances thrill with efficiency and longevity, park operators can secure a sustainable and profitable future.
